Post-Meal Fiber Shots Market to Surpass USD 545 Million by 2036 as Consumers Embrace Convenient Metabolic Wellness and Post-Meal Routines

The global post-meal fiber shots market is gaining strong momentum as health-conscious consumers seek compact, convenient formats to support post-meal glucose moderation, satiety, and digestive regularity without crossing into regulated medical territory. According to Fact.MR, the market is projected to grow from USD 148.5 million in 2026 to USD 545.7 million by 2036, registering a robust CAGR of 13.90% during the forecast period. The market is expected to generate an absolute dollar opportunity of approximately USD 397.2 million over the decade.

This expansion is driven by rising meal-response awareness, growing demand for low-sugar wellness routines, and the popularity of habit-forming DTC subscription models. Active lifestyle consumers, metabolic wellness users, and weight-management cohorts are increasingly adopting fiber shots as a practical daily tool that fits seamlessly after meals. Brands are focusing on soluble fiber, resistant dextrin, and clean-label formulations to deliver taste, tolerance, and convenience in ready-to-drink shot formats.

While the United States leads with advanced DTC and pharmacy channels, Germany, Japan, China, and India are emerging as high-growth markets supported by e-commerce, pharmacy placement, and rising urban wellness trends. As consumers prioritize food-first metabolic support, post-meal fiber shots are evolving from general fiber supplements into a targeted, occasion-based wellness category.

Market Overview

The global post-meal fiber shots market surpassed USD 136.2 million in 2025 and is estimated at USD 148.5 million in 2026 before expanding to USD 545.7 million by 2036. These compact liquid shots and concentrated formats deliver soluble fiber and functional ingredients to support post-meal routines, distinguishing them from traditional powders, gummies, or broad digestive supplements.

Rising glucose-awareness, wearable-driven health tracking, and preference for non-prescription wellness tools are accelerating adoption across DTC, pharmacy, and health store channels.

Key Growth Drivers

  • Increasing meal-response awareness among metabolic wellness and weight-management consumers.
  • Demand for convenient satiety and digestive support without stimulants or prescription products.
  • Growth of DTC subscription models that encourage repeat monthly usage and habit formation.
  • Expansion of pharmacy and nutrition clinic placement that builds credibility for post-meal claims.
  • Low-sugar wellness trends and clean-label positioning that align with daily nutrition routines.

Technology & Innovation Trends

Innovation focuses on low-viscosity soluble fiber and resistant dextrin formulations that ensure pleasant taste and minimal digestive discomfort. Brands are launching flavored shots, multipacks, and bundles with coaching apps or flavor rotations to improve compliance. Polyphenols, botanical extracts, and disciplined chromium use are being incorporated for added differentiation while maintaining clear wellness positioning.

The shot format enables precise dosing, quick consumption, and portability, making it ideal for post-meal rituals.

Market Challenges & Restraints

  • Claim compliance risks around glucose and sugar-balance language to avoid medical oversteps.
  • Digestive tolerance issues with concentrated fiber, especially for new users.
  • Competition from established formats such as powders, gummies, and nutrition drinks.
  • Consumer confusion between wellness shots and clinical diabetes-management products.

Segment Analysis

  • By Functional Claim: Post-meal glucose moderation is expected to hold a 39.0% share in 2026, driven by active meal-response tracking.
  • By Ingredient: Soluble fiber leads with a 42.0% share in 2026 due to familiarity and ease of communication.
  • By Consumer Cohort: Metabolic wellness users account for 36.0% share in 2026, seeking practical food-first support.
  • By Channel: DTC subscription leads with a 32.0% share in 2026, supported by repeat-purchase convenience.
  • By Claim Territory: Post-meal support dominates with a 40.0% share in 2026, offering clear and compliant positioning.

Regional Analysis

North America, led by the United States (15.0% CAGR), remains at the forefront due to strong DTC brands, pharmacy shelves, and glucose-awareness communities. Europe, with Germany at 14.3% CAGR, benefits from structured wellness claims and pharmacy trust. Japan (13.9% CAGR) favors compact, portion-controlled formats, while China (13.4% CAGR) and India (12.9% CAGR) are scaling rapidly through e-commerce and urban adoption.

Competitive Landscape

The post-meal fiber shots market features established supplement companies and metabolic wellness players. Competition centers on claim discipline, fiber tolerance, flavor quality, repeat-purchase programs, and channel trust. Brands that deliver convenient post-meal timing and transparent wellness positioning are gaining an edge over generic fiber products.

Leading Companies Analysis

Key participants include Thorne, NOW Foods, GNC, Metamucil / P&G, Benefiber / Haleon, and Garden of Life. These companies leverage strong fiber expertise, clean-label credibility, and broad distribution networks. Thorne’s FiberMend and NOW Foods’ Fiber-3 are notable examples of soluble fiber positioning that supports the category’s growth.

Investment & Strategic Developments

Brands are investing in shot-specific formulations, subscription bundles, and pharmacy multipacks. Companies are expanding trial packs on Amazon and partnering with nutrition clinics to educate consumers on proper post-meal use while maintaining compliant claims.
